Apple Lucked Out, but It Wasn't Him

The late 1980s and early 1990s were the years on the Apple timeline when the company still had a lot of diehard fans. The Newton was an early handheld device that kind of hinted at what Apple would be able to accomplish many years later with the iPhone. It's indisputable that Steve Jobs returned to Apple in 1997 was the company's next big turning point.
